SPRINGLANDS, CORENTYNE – Kevin Narine, called ‘Long Hair,’ of several places of abode, arrived in Guyana from neighbouring Suriname at about 11:30 hours yesterday.
The man is suspected to be heading a gang of pirates that wreaked havoc on the seas for a number of years.
The suspect was caught last year in Suriname, and the authorities there had kept him in custody. While in Suriname he had a number of charged slapped on him.
A source from the Guyana Police Force indicated that two detectives left Guyana via Moleson Creek on Saturday for Nieuw Nickerie to escort the prisoner.
In Guyana he also will face several charges, including armed robbery, possession of arms and ammunition, and attempted murder.
‘Long Hair’ was identified by police in both Guyana and Suriname.
